I had a fridge in a slide out that had an automatic fan that would come on when the temp at the back of the fridge got high. The sensor would go out very often, so since I was camping full time I went to WallyWorld and got a $10 squirrel cage fan and let it vent the back of the fridge all of the time. Reduced my interior fridge temp from 45 down to about 38. Did that for about 3 years.
